Transaction 58ea9d823e925a7461a530c20a8fe5f0fea38e169161d4e241ae3fc951682407
1 Input
1 Output
-
58ea9d823e925a7461a530c20a8fe5f0fea38e169161d4e241ae3fc951682407:0
- value
- 75972029
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c7aa32177d04637ef84e9fdb52f343a2ff02c5c
- address
- bc1qd3a2xgth6prr0muya87m2te58ghlqtzuyuu22j